9 weeks now on IV antibiotics and not any significant improvement in symptoms. In fact I have been feeling much worse many days which may mean the bacterial spirochetes are being killed off and I am experiencing a HERX reaction from the 2 strong antibiotics.  In a few more weeks I will hook up with my Lyme specialist and see what his thoughts are and where we go from that point.  Maybe add in some supplements or change up or add in another antibiotic to break up the spirochetes that have been chased into the cyst form of the disease.

    Well it is now 2013 and I am starting to feel more positive about how all this will turn out.
      I found out last year that I did indeed have Lyme Borrelosis that was found in a direct blood culture back east. I have had severe head pain and neurological symptoms for almost 3 years; the most debilitating I have ever been. But I  have been working with a great Lyme literate dr. and have been on IV antibiotic now for about 6 weeks now. It is a slow process to kill off the bacterial spirochetes but both my husband and I are trying our best to take it a day at a time.
     The bad news of course, all the treatments, PICC line etc. is being paid for out of pocket all because of the IDSA ( Infectious Disease Society of America) and the CDC are running the whole "show" here and have set up the guidelines going on 12 year old false science for the health ins. companies not to cover the cost of people like myself who has probably had Chronic Lyme Disease for many many years and didn't even know it.
